Global Logistics Management
is a specialized field that focuses on the planning, coordination, and execution of the movement of goods, products, and resources across international borders.
Global Logistics Management plays a vital role in today's interconnected world, where businesses need to navigate complex supply chains and manage risks associated with global trade.
